There are various forms of art that have come and gone, but the history of pop art states that it started in Great Britain in the early 1950s and in the United States of America in the late 1950s. What is pop art? Pop art has been considered as one of the prominent art movements of the last century. The prime characteristics of this genre of art are the theme and techniques that are derived from popular mass culture that include advertisements and comic books. The aim of this form of art was to use images that are popular rather than the typical one’s used in the elitist type of art.

According to the experts who have capsuled this form of art, consider this to have been an offshoot of an entire pop art movement that gave rise to also pop music and pop literature (actually known as popular literature – basic writings that the common man could relate too). The entire movement has been more of a western phenomenon, and so a pop art gallery is hardly visible in India. However, most galleries do host exhibitions of popular art.

One visiting Britain, USA and Japan would easily find an active pop art gallery at any point. And interestingly the artwork is not as expensive as other forms of art. This art is for the common man. Though some artists do quote higher prices because of the reputation they have earned over the years.

Through the years there have been some world renowned pop art artists, who have contributed towards popularizing this form of art all over the world. Some famous names are:

- Jasper Johns
- Robert Rauschenberg
- Roy Lichtenstein
- Andy Warhol
- James Rosenquist
- Eduardo Arroyo
-  Alfredo Alcaín
- Kaikai Kiki
- Yoshitomo Nara
- Takashi Murakami
